Kobelco excavator-parts distributors often receive this requirement under S5047, M3T95071 or an ME-series Mitsubishi number. Linking the reference to the Mitsubishi 6D22 engine and the 24V 5.5kW 13T configuration gives the sales team a clear product identity before it quotes replacement or branch stock.
The cross-reference group also contains Hyundai-format numbers, but those numbers do not by themselves turn every enquiry into a Hyundai application. The stated buying scope is Mitsubishi 6D22 in Kobelco equipment; the removed starter still needs to agree on pinion, mounting triangle, drive-end depth and terminal position.
The product specification combines 24V, 5.5kW, thirteen teeth, module 3.5 and clockwise rotation. Keeping the complete set on the quotation and receiving label helps distributors separate this heavy-duty unit from similar Mitsubishi starters that share a housing family but use another pinion or mounting relationship.

Thirteen teeth describe the pinion count, while module 3.5 identifies the gear size and engagement relationship. A starter may share the general Mitsubishi housing pattern but use another gear. Recording both values with clockwise rotation prevents a visually similar unit from being accepted on pinion count alone.
Compare all three diameter-14 mounting holes, the diameter-100 drive-end reference, and the 66 mm and 86 mm axial values. The front drawing also shows 142 mm, 133 mm and 102 mm mounting references. Use a straight drive-end photograph so the hole pattern is reviewed without perspective distortion.

Load-test the 24V battery bank, measure voltage drop across positive and ground cables during cranking, and verify the start signal and relay operation. Inspect the ring gear and cable connections as well. Supplying these readings with the claim gives the distributor useful evidence for warranty review instead of relying only on a no-crank description.
